 Following the issue of a 7-yr old girl killed by a 200Level Student of University  of Port Harcourt for ritual purpose.

Another police officer, a Divisional Police Officer (DPO) in Rivers State, is in police custody for his complicity in the disappearance of a murder suspect and ritualists, Ifeanyi Dike, who killed an eight-year-old for alleged money ritual.
The DPO was arrested on Monday and he is alleged to work in hand in hand with Johnbosco Okoroeze, the investigation police officer (IPO), who was in charge of the case, when the alleged murderer escaped.
Sergeant Okoroeze was dismissed last week from the Nigerian Police after an orderly room trial and arraigned for aiding Dike to escape.
It was gathered that while preparations were ongoing by both the father of the deceased, Ernest Nmezuwuba, and the suspect (Dike) to write their statements, several calls were received from the said DPO by Okoroeze.
The top police source said, “We have enough evidence to believe that the DPO was working hand in hand with the ex-sergeant, who has been remanded in police custody. The DPO has been arrested.
“Even the father of the girl that was killed had said that there was communication with the IPO (dismissed sergeant) handling the matter and somebody that has not been disclosed. This happened while they were bringing the suspected ritual killer to the State Police Headquarters.
“All these and many more will serve as evidence against the DPO, who we believe has a lot to explain about his possible involvement in the escape of Ifeanyi Dike, who killed an eight-year-old boy, ostensibly for money ritual.”
Dike had allegedly raped, killed and removed vital organs of an eight-year-old girl, Victory Chikamso, before escaping from police custody.
Dike, said to be a 200-level student of the University of Port Harcourt, was said to be on his way to dispose of the body when he was caught and then handed over to the police on tge wee hours of August 19.
